Thanks for your response. However, I need to be able to give my client access to see those submissions and stats without them being able to see all my forms in my account. Is there a way to do that?
-
MikeReplied on September 27, 2017 at 5:24 PM
You may consider the following options:
1) Share a password protected submissions page with your client.
- How to Share Form's Submissions Page
2) Share a form access in a sub-user mode.
- How to Share Forms with a Sub-Account User
3) Use reporting options. For example, there are grid and html table reports available.
